EPHF 4: Social participation in health

null

This function includes:

• Strengthening the power of citizens to change their own lifestyles and take an active role in developing healthy behaviors and environments, thus giving them influence over the decisions that affect their health and access to adequate public health services.
• Facilitating organized community participation in the decisions and actions related to health programs of prevention, diagnosis, treatment, and rehabilitation, aiming to improve the population’s health status and create an environment that promotes healthy lifestyles.

Indicators:

1. Strength of the influence that citizens have in public health decision-making.
2. Strength of the social participation in health.
3. Advisory services and technical support for sub-national entities to strengthen social participation in health.
